Actor, author, storyteller, and comic, Darryl Henriques gained a loyal following while living in Berkeley in the 1980s for his work with the San Francisco Mime Troupe and the influential street theater performers, East Bay Sharks.
His satirical conservationist book, 50 Simple Things You Can Do to Pave the Earth (Ulysses), topped the charts shortly after he left town, and Darryl's credits in film, TV, and other life-impersonating situations include roles in Star Trek VI and The 13th Floor.
A master of stream-of-consciousness observation, Darryl returns to his old Berkeley haunt, offering a glimpse of his uniquely skewed, comedic vision of the world.
